    Abstract: The present invention relates to a method for preparing magnesium lithospermate B. The method is characterized in that: magnesium lithospermate B is extracted or purified from a Salvia miltiorrhiza plant material or a Salvia miltiorrhiza extract in the presence of an added magnesium salt. The present invention also relates to a high-purity magnesium lithospermate B product prepared by the method of the present invention, wherein the content of magnesium lithospermate B is more than 95% by weight.

    Abstract: An automatically provisioned network element (26) has the ability to detect a heartbeat message interval used by a remote network element (22, 24) and to automatically adjust a heartbeat interval timer value that it uses for sending subsequent heartbeat messages. The adjustment is responsive to the interval used by the remote network element 50 that they correspond to each other. By automatically configuring the heartbeat timer interval value so that there is correspondence between the intervals used by the end points on a link over which Cisco HDLC SLARP communications occur, for example, the chance of a link being considered to have failed is decreased. In a disclosed example, the heartbeat interval timer value is initially set to a value that is expected to be higher than that used by the remote network element and only automatic reductions in the heartbeat message interval timer value are permitted.
